Tcjeepdriver- Saharas use 18"wheels and 32" tires, not 28". You can go up to 33" tall but less than 11" wide without lift, without wheel spacers. You may have to do a minor steer-stop adjustment. Look into wheel spacers to increase track: (a) it looks great (b) decreases roll in turns.
